Postgraduate Certificate in Cognitive Behavioural Therapy in Addiction Recovery

The Postgraduate Certificate in Cognitive Behavioural Therapy in Addiction Recovery equips professionals with advanced skills to address addiction through evidence-based practices. Designed for counsellors, therapists, and healthcare practitioners, this program focuses on CBT techniques tailored for addiction recovery.


Participants will learn to assess, treat, and support individuals struggling with addiction, fostering long-term recovery. The curriculum blends theory and practical application, ensuring real-world readiness. Ideal for those seeking to enhance their expertise and make a meaningful impact in addiction care.

Course Content

  • • Foundations of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T) Principles
    • Understanding Addiction: Psychological and Biological Perspectives
    • CBT Techniques for Managing Cravings and Relapse Prevention
    • Motivational Interviewing in Addiction Recovery
    • Trauma-Informed CBT Approaches for Co-Occurring Disorders
    • Group Therapy and CBT in Addiction Treatment Settings
    • Ethical and Professional Practice in CBT for Addiction Recovery
    • Case Formulation and Treatment Planning in Addiction Contexts
    • Self-Care and Burnout Prevention for Therapists in Addiction Recovery
    • Evaluating Outcomes and Measuring Progress in CBT Interventions

Career Path

CBT Therapists in Addiction Recovery: Specialists who apply cognitive behavioural therapy techniques to support individuals overcoming addiction. High demand in NHS and private healthcare sectors.

Substance Misuse Counsellors: Professionals providing tailored counselling to individuals struggling with substance abuse. Key roles in rehabilitation centres and community health services.

Mental Health Support Workers: Frontline staff assisting individuals with mental health challenges, often collaborating with CBT therapists in addiction recovery settings.

Clinical Psychologists: Experts in diagnosing and treating mental health disorders, including addiction, using evidence-based therapies like CBT.

Rehabilitation Coordinators: Professionals managing recovery programmes, ensuring seamless integration of CBT techniques in addiction treatment plans.
